KUALA LUMPUR, Malaysia –
7 July 2023 – KPJ Healthcare Berhad (“KPJ Healthcare” or the “Group”), Malaysia’s largest
private healthcare provider, has signed a Memorandum of Understanding (MoU) with Gentari Sdn Bhd
(“Gentari”), a leading clean energy solutions provider, to embark on a strategic collaboration that will
drive decarbonisation efforts in the healthcare sector and propel KPJ Healthcare towards sustainable
growth.
By joining forces with
Gentari, KPJ Healthcare is set to integrate green mobility and renewable energy solutions into KPJ
Healthcare’s operations, positioning the Group at the forefront of driving positive environmental impact
through clean energy solutions. This partnership marks a significant milestone in KPJ Healthcare’s
commitment to sustainability and sets the stage for the widespread deployment of clean energy ecosystems
across the Group’s extensive network of hospitals.
One of the key areas of
collaboration outlined in the MoU is the installation of electric vehicle (“EV”) charging facilities at 10
KPJ Healthcare premises. These charging facilities will be made available to the public soon, on a
pay-per-use basis, supporting Malaysia’s growing EV infrastructure and encouraging EV adoption among
staff, patients, and visitors.
This collaboration aligns
with the ambitious targets set by the Malaysian government, aiming to establish 10,000 charging points by
2025 and have 1.3 million EVs on the road by 2040. By installing EV charging stations at KPJ Healthcare
hospitals, this collaboration aims to contribute to these national targets, reduce carbon emissions, and
promote sustainable transportation. In addition to providing better accessibility to EV charging
facilities at KPJ Healthcare hospitals, the joint effort also aims to drive awareness, educate
stakeholders, and influence policy frameworks to create an enabling environment and accelerate the
transition towards sustainable operations and widespread EV adoption across the country.
Beyond EV charging
facilities, the collaboration will introduce Zero Emission Vehicle Fleet solutions tailored to the
Malaysian market by exploring options which may include the adoption of EVs to reduce greenhouse gas
emissions and promote sustainable transportation in the healthcare sector.
In addition to green
mobility, the collaboration also extends to exploring the deployment of renewable energy solutions within
KPJ Healthcare’s facilities. This may include the installation of solar and other clean energy
technologies to harness renewable sources and generate electricity, thereby reducing the Group’s reliance
on fossil fuels and decreasing its overall carbon footprint.
